Highspire, PA, is a small borough located along the Susquehanna River, just a mile from Harrisburg International Airport. With a rich industrial history, Highspire was once known for its logging industry, flour mills, and whiskey distilleries. Today, the borough maintains a neighborly community with under 3,000 residents and a bi-monthly newsletter. The main thoroughfare, 2nd Street, connects Highspire to Steelton and Harrisburg and features local mom-and-pop shops, cafes, and vehicle dealers. Home styles in Highspire reflect early 20th-century architecture, including Cape Cod styles, cottages, bungalows, and Foursquare styles, many with brick exteriors and traditional details. The housing market is competitive due to lower prices and reasonable taxes. Highspire shares the Steelton-Highspire School District with Steelton, serving students from kindergarten through twelfth grade. Recreational spaces include Highspire Memorial Park, with playgrounds and courts, and Highspire Reservoir Park, offering serene walking paths through wetlands. Community events such as the Arbor Day Celebration, hosted by the Highspire Historical Society, involve tree planting and care. Residents have convenient access to the Pennsylvania Turnpike and Interstate 283, and can use regional CAT buses for commuting.
On average, homes in Highspire, PA sell after 19 days on the market compared to the national average of 53 days. The median sale price for homes in Highspire, PA over the last 12 months is $190,000, down 6%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
